3HSDB Hazardous Substances Data Bank
comprehensive peer-reviewed information on
hazardous chemical substances
- Includes
- Human exposure symptoms
- Physical properties
- Emergency handling procedures
- Environmental fate
4HSDB Hazardous Substances Data Bank
Sources of information in HSDB
- DOT 2000 Emergency Response Guidebook
- U.S. Coast Guard, CHRIS Hazardous Chemical Data
- NFPA Fire Protection Guide to Hazardous Materials
- NIOSH Pocket Guide to Chemical Hazards
- EPA Integrated Risk Information System (IRIS)
- POISINDEX(R) Information System, Micromedex,
Inc., CCIS - TOMES(R) Information System, Micromedex, Inc.,
CCIS - ACGIH Guidelines Select of Chem Protect Clothing
- American Conference of Governmental Industrial
Hygienists, TLVs BEIs - Association of American Railroads, Emergency
Handling of Hazardous Materials in Surface
Transportation, Association of American
Railroads, Bureau of Explosives - and many others.

13WISER- Future Directions
- Other devices in addition to Palm
- Action oriented - workflow (SOPs)
- Integrate with other incident factors (e.g.,
weather conditions, type of incident, terrain) - Substance category (vs. named) data
- Biological radiological agent data
- Wireless interaction and dynamic data transfer
- Companion web-based training game
- Integrated patient care and reporting
14WISER Availability
- Prototype Release available now with 44
chemical substances - Operational Version Deployment
- Version 1 (Spring 2004) 400 chemical substances
- Focus Groups/Feedback Spring/Summer
- Enhanced Version 2 (Fall 2004)
- Enhancement Phases and Staged Release
- Cross platform Pocket PC version, Windows OS
- New functionality
- Wireless capability
- Additional data sources
